12 miles in 15 degrees
Got out for a 12-miler in the Cleveland Metroparks with a fellow insane rider. About half on pavement, half on snow/ice-packed paths.
Rode the CX rig with some Nokian W106 Hakkapeliitta 35C's. Studs are totally worth it.
Never lost control, but did some rear-wheel drifting on downhill turns. Prettay, prettay cold out.
